At $631 per month, the association fees are relatively high for a one-bedroom unit, which may impact the overall monthly carrying costs and affordability for some buyers.
Constructed in 1972, the building's older infrastructure may require more frequent maintenance or potential future assessments compared to newer developments in the West Hollywood area.
